DESCRIPTION:Although we’d love art to ‘speak for itself’\, sometimes we need to communicate\, negotiate and manage the conflict that comes with creative professionalism. \n\n\n\nWorking professionally in the arts and creative sector means communicating with a diverse range of people across an array of complicated circumstances. Any ordinary day could include managing a new professional relationship\, negotiating your fees\, umpiring an argument or setting better boundaries for the work. Much of the time\, we have no clues or tools to help us at all! \n\n\n\nThe Art of Negotiation is a practical workshop packed with real-life activities and fun challenges to help creatives learn the basics of negotiation and conflict resolution – all in the safety of a friendly workshop space. \n\n\n\nREGISTER NOW \n\n\n\nYou will learn the following\, with a special focus on arts practice and creative industries: \n\n\n\n+  The basic elements of effective negotiating\, for any professional circumstance.+  Different negotiating styles\, and how to create a ‘win-win’ scenario.+  Understanding how to minimise the idea of a ‘zero sum game’.+  Tips and tricks on better ways to say NO.+  A visual aid to assist with mapping conflicts to achieve the best resolutions for all. \n\n\n\nPractical exercises and ‘homework’ will be provided for all the discussed strategies. \n\n\n\nWhat do I get?All participants of this workshop also receive: \n\n\n\n+ Contacts and support tools for participants who need more resources for mediation.+ Copies of leading texts covering business communication\, active listening and mediation.+ A selection of reports and guides on the topic from Harvard University’s Program on Negotiation. \n\n\n\nPlus you’ll also get…+ A practical workbook to help with elements of the workshop.+ Lifetime access to a Dropbox folder jam-packed with additional resources and helpful links.+ Access to additional free webinars to supplement the material covered in the workshop.+ Information on how to access further one-to-one business advice\, mentoring and support from one of our creative industries business specialist advisors. \n\n\n\nWho is presenting?Monica Davidson is an award-winning expert on the creative industries\, who began her professional life as a freelance journalist\, performer\, and filmmaker. DESCRIPTION:This is a CREATIVE PLUS BUSINESS event as part of INfuse\, made possible by Creative Brimbank. \n\n\n\nWhat should I charge? This question plagues creative practitioners and arts no matter what industry. There are answers\, but they are fascinating and complicated. \n\n\n\nWorking out what to charge for creative products and services can be a colossal challenge. Where to even start? Pricing For Creatives is a practical workshop that covers the basics of figuring out the price point for creative work\, including calculating costs and understanding the marketplace what to charge for creative products and services.  \n\n\n\n‘What’s Worth’ is vital for any creative struggling to understand the value of their own work\, and how to share that value with others.
